Yeah Omega Red can easily be swapped for any other high power 4 drop. Crossbones, Jessica Jones, White Queen all should be fine. But the professor really needs the Daredevil here I think. Without that you’re better with a different 5 drop entirely. His job is 100% to either snipe locations like the Altar of Sacrifice or to use DD to read a location to steal.

Spider-Man could work instead of Professor X? With Storm and Cosmo there’s already a ton of lockdown, so Spidey locking down just the one lane for round 6 will constrain them a ton.

Also, the obvious counterplay to Kingpin is for the opponent to just play their cards on that location in round 6. Spider-Man can counter that. Kingpin on 3, Spiderman on the Kingpin lane in 5, and then Aero or Magneto on 6 on the same lane.

As for what to put sub for DD for a 2-cost, it feels like Mojo would have good synergy with Magneto (use the pulled-in cards to trigger Mojo’s ability). Kraven too, but might telegraph your gameplan a bit too much? Invisible Woman would be nice for hiding Kingpin, but would make it a Cosmo magnet.

Yeah there are several ways to counter this, filling the location does work, but at the cost of me dictating where you play to greater or lesser degrees. Also in most cases one Magneto has more power than 2-3 cards totaling 6 cost.

What I like to do is turn 3 play Storm or Kingpin, follow up with Juggernaut in that lane (winning it outright with Storm or keeping it more clear with Kingpin). This often means that if that lane is still open, they will try and play their turn 5, usually giving me a lane opening for Professor X. Then I can Magneto either into the Kingpin lane, or pull cards away from the Storm lane.

It doesn’t always work, and flexibility is key. But generally between all the cards that move opponent cards, or force them into/ away from certain lanes there is an opportunity there.

Brood-Surfer is, as always, the biggest failure point. In theory X and Cosmo can negate that, but in practice the Sera-Surfer deck is still the one that is most likely to beat you. No shock as it is hands down the best deck in the game by a fair margin (only Darkhawk-Zabu comes close)
